Darrell K Royal Stadium, need seatingsuggestions
Well my wife and I have decided were are going to our first UT game this coming fall and are trying to decide where to sit. I am not paying $350 per ticket, so most of the middle seating is out. I was looking into sections 2,3,7,or possibly 30 (visitor sideline). Can anyone give me a suggestion on which of these sections would be better? Appreciate the help.

If it's an evening game and you want to stay out of the sun get seats on the home side. All those sections are pretty much the same, but I would shoot for the closest to the 50 you can get. You will have fun wherever you sit .

I would recommend staying out of the west side upper deck. Most of those seats suck. If you're patient and you can wait don't buy any tickets until close to the game you want to go see. Actually the best place to buy tickets is on game day out in front of Scholz's beer garden. There are people selling them everywhere. Bring you a stadium seating diagram so you'll know where the seats are. You shouldn't pay more than face if you're patient. Good luck and Hook'em!

I've never not been able to get good tickets myself or ever heard of anyone not being able to get good tickets around the stadium on game day. If you just have to have tickets in-hand before the game, try the swap meet section on hornfans.com or the rivals/Texas website rather than going to ebay, stub hub or any other ticket resale place. Also, it's a good idea to make your hotel reservations in advance because on game day weekends they fill up fast in Austin.
